Artifacts of Learning

Teachers can submit up to 8 artifacts of learning.  All artifacts must be submitted by April 11th.  You must submit a minimum of 1 artifact.  The artifacts are only evaluated on Domains 1 & 4.  In Learning Cultures specific artifacts are things like CUR and Conference records, standards checklists, etc.  In addition to any of these, you may choose any thing you choose.  Below is a list of examples.  If you want to include something not on the list, you are free to do so.  You just want to submit enough items such that each indicator can be evaluated at least once.


The artifacts comprise 5% of the overall rating from Domains 1 & 4.  At the end of the year summative meeting where we go over your final rating for the year, you'll get to see all the rating for each of the artifacts.  At UAI, we're aiming to begin end-of-year summative conferences in May and finish all year-end conferences by June.
